Diels-Alder reactions of fluoroallene. An affirmation of homo-lumo control.

open access: yesTetrahedron Letters, 1980
Abstract The Diels-Alder reactions of fluoroallene proceed with regiospecific addition to the C 2 C 3 bond. Mechanistic implications of these results are discussed.

High‐Power Rapid Laser‐Induced Synthesis of Multi‐functional Cobalt Metal‐Organic Framework With an Unprecedented Synthesis Efficiency

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
Laser‐assisted synthesis enables rapid (within 1 h) and high‐yield (≥90%) production of Co‐MOFs with mesoporous structures, tunable magnetic and optical properties, and efficient adsorption of N2, CH4, and CO2 for low‐energy gas separation. DFT calculations elucidate the electronic structure and adsorption behavior.
